Megan Ellis, founder and licensed occupational therapist, began riding at age four and developed a lifelong connection to the horse–human partnership. Today, she integrates that passion into her clinical work using hippotherapy, sensory integration, nature-based therapy, and trauma-informed care. She has completed training through the American Hippotherapy Association (Level I & II) and USC’s Sensory Integration CE Certification Program. Megan takes a personalized, relationship-based approach to help each client build skills, confidence, and independence in daily life.
